Who’s it for?

This training is for anyone who works in an anchor institution, be that local government, health or education institution, public services, housing or the private sector, who wants practical steps and an action plan to orientating their organisation’s activity towards building community wealth in their place.

Why attend?

Community wealth building has been proven to bring real benefits to local people and places, as exemplified by the success of the Preston Model. A growing number of towns and cities across the UK are adopting this new approach, buoyed by an awareness of its necessity from the anchor institutions in those places. This course provides an action plan for institutions to adopt a community wealth building approach and become truly rooted in the economic success of their place.

Attend this course if you want to join a growing movement of Community Wealth Builders who are succeeding in finding new ways to realise economic, social, and environmental benefits in their local communities.
